How does the regulatory landscape impact the South Korea dual element ultrasound probe market?
South Korea’s regulatory environment for medical devices is stringent but transparent, fostering a stable market for ultrasound probes. Compliance with local standards is critical for market entry and sustained growth.
- Strict approval processes managed by the Ministry of Food and Drug Safety (MFDS)
- Emphasis on safety, efficacy, and quality standards for medical devices
- Growing regulatory support for innovative and AI-enabled diagnostic tools
- Alignment with international standards to facilitate exports
Regulatory developments influence product development timelines and market strategies, encouraging manufacturers to prioritize compliance and quality assurance. This environment also incentivizes local innovation to meet domestic standards.
